Fig. 5 shows a wheel W pivoted at its centre, O and held stationary by string and a spring. The tension in the string is T and the force on the springs is F. Use this information to answer questions a) and b)

a) State how the magnitude of T and F compare. Give reasons for your answer
b) State what would happen to the wheel if the string snapped

a) T is less than F i.e. T < F

moments of T and F about O are equal, but the perpendicular distance from O to T is greater than the perpendicular distance from O to F. The Resultant moment is therefore zero

b) The wheel would turn in an anticlockwise direction about O
